Boro face longer McManus absence

Last updated : 17 November 2010 By BBC Sport

McManus tore ankle ligaments 39 minutes into Middlesbrough's 2-1 home win over Crystal Palace on 6 November.

Up until that point the 28-year-old had played every minute of Middlesbrough's league campaign this season.

He has made 32 appearances for the club since an initial loan move from Celtic in January last season.

The transfer was finalised in July, with Boro paying £1.5m to secure the international defender on a three-year contract.
